Minor Hotels, a global hospitality group that owns and operates over 560 hotels, resorts and residences in 58 countries, has announced the signing of an agreement between its Chinese joint venture, Funyard Minor, and Chongqing Yuanchu Luquan Cultural Tourism Group to develop Anantara Clear Water Bay Sanya Resort. Slated to debut in October 2027, the 90-key Anantara Hotels & Resorts property will be situated along Clear Water Bay’s 12-kilometre stretch of fine, white sandy beach, known as one of the world’s three 'Singing Beaches.' Read MoreStellar collection of partners for the inaugural event also announced, including Richard Mille as official timing partner The inaugural Anantara Concorso Roma, presented by UBS, will take place on 24-27 April, with final preparations being made in the lead up to the glamourous event. Celebrating ‘La dolce vita’ and all things Italian, including hospitality, cuisine and craftsmanship, the event also takes place 100 years from the very first Concorso d’Eleganza which was held in Rome in April 1926. Read MoreLocated 250 km southwest of Abu Dhabi, Anantara Sir Bani Yas Island Abu Dhabi Resorts is the UAE’s largest natural island, renowned for its commitment to sustainability and conservation. Home to three distinct Anantara properties, the island offers a variety of experiences to cater to every type of discerning traveller. Anantara Al Yamm Villa Resort has reopened with a revitalised beachfront retreat, featuring refreshed villas with stunning views of the Arabian Gulf, perfect for romantic getaways and special occasions. Meanwhile, Anantara Al Sahel Villa Resort introduces family friendly safari-inspired villas that blend harmoniously with the island’s natural beauty.
